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Beech | Ciervo Porquerizo de los Calamianes |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(planta)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Chordata (cordados)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Mammalia (mamíferos) |
| Order | Fagales (Beeches & Oaks) | Artiodactyla (artiodáctilos) |
| Family | Fagaceae (Beech Family) | Cervidae (Deer) |
| Genus | Fagus | Axis |
| Species | Fagus sylvatica | Axis calamianensis |
